And, hmm, looking at how it all fits together I'm thinking we need some kind of tree. Or at least some tall vegetation (or something passing for that). The world looks quite empty without it.

Also, I'm noticing some stutter sometimes when walking around the cloud level. It seems to be caused by the game dynamically loading/unloading assets (such as textures and animations) too frequently. What the game does for its own level types is include common assets and prefabs in the dependencies of the world entity, preventing that. So I think we really need to have our own cloudrealm entity, for the sake of smooth gameplay.
